Typically situations, hotel house owners are likely to look at a spa as an individual device to ascertain if it is worthwhile or not or simply a viable investment. When It appears to seem sensible it is not generally the most effective to come to a decision if so as to add a spa. Where the spa fits into your revenue statement also is dependent upon the way you framework the administration on the spa (tenant, resort owned and operated, resort owned but run by administration company, and so forth.). Spas are particularly labor intense and you should work hard to build a steady stream of customers. Most lodge spas, Based on a current report published by STR Global operate at a 33% treatment space utilization charge. There are numerous set labor costs but in most compensation designs for spas make an incredible quantity of variable labor prices. This would make the COGS really large and profit margins incredibly minimal. One other point to recall about getting a spa is that the treatment rooms is usually occupied multiple times per day not like a hotel place that could only be occupied once daily. This is also crucial that you consider when identifying the dimensions within your spa. In addition there are numerous compensation versions and value constructions To guage to choose which will be most rewarding for your organization. This can be why reporting a income for that spa by yourself will become pretty tough and sensitive. The point is that the stand by itself spa, in most cases, isn't an Particularly desirable financial investment Except it serves a singular and attentive niche for instance a health and fitness or specialised resort. Monte Zwang of Wellness Money Administration introduced in Nashville's Working day Spa Association's Pro Awareness Network that the typical working day spa incorporates a net gain of only four to fifteen%.

Due to these few matters, you need to look at a resort spa differently to find out its value. This is certainly greatest illustrated in an case in point. Suppose a hotel decides to develop a reasonably lavish 6000 square foot spa which charges $two,000,000. Your feasibility analyze forecasts the spa will make yet another $1,200,000 as a Section. Immediately after undistributed operating fees, the spa's money is around $240,000. This certainly appears to be that you choose to ROI will probably be quite a long time coming. But Let's take a look at this another way.

Suppose in exactly the same instance, the lodge has three hundred keys at an ADR of $a hundred and fifty.00 and is also operating at an occupancy charge of 70% yielding a revPAR of $64,695 and revPOR of $253 including further Office revenues. Its complete income is $19,408,623 using a Internet running money of $six,573,664 The feasibility study forecasts that by including a spa, occupancy will boost 5.7% and also the hotel can increase its ADR by ten%. For the reason that hotel's occupancy will improve, it may also expect comparable increases in other Office revenues. Using this forecast and including the extra profits generated from the new spa Section, rooms revenues will boost sixteen.29% ($1,872,450) and total earnings will enhance 22.47% ($4,360,834) just before departmental expenses and undistributed running fees. Web working money enhances by 19.eleven% ($1,256,328). By analyzing the addition of the spa in this way, you are able to see the ROI is way better and comes about a lot more promptly than if you have been to only Examine the ROI using the spa's 20% income ($240,000) Component this into your capitalization rate and you can see simply how much your house's price has increased. To simplify, begin to see the summary down below.

Complete Revenues: Devoid of Spa - $ 19,408,628; With Spa - $ 23,769,456; Maximize - $ four,360,834 (22.forty seven%)

NOI: Without the need of Spa - $ 6,573,664; With Spa - $ seven,829,992; Maximize - $ one,256,328 (19.eleven)

Net Earnings: Devoid of Spa - $ four,351,377; With Spa - $ 5,153,389; Raise - $ 802,012 (eighteen.43%)

RevPAR: Without having Spa - $ 64,695; With Spa - $ 79,232; Boost - $ 14,537 (22.47%)

RevPOR: Devoid of Spa - $253; With Spa - $293; Maximize - $forty (15.81%)

Occupancy: Without having Spa - 70%; With Spa - 74%

Typical Day by day Level: With no Spa - $a hundred and fifty; With Spa - $one hundred sixty five

A number of you might be thinking that this is also superior being true and you may be correct. These projections are according to a feasibility analyze that was carried out inside a industry that created perception to include a spa. Not all spa's can undertaking $one,200,000 in profits and not all inns could possibly get away with raising their ADR and every resort's expenses are unique. You must relate this instance to your very own situation. Acquiring stated that, Let us take a look at another instance. If a similar home won't increase their ADR but did increase their occupancy, they might sill realize an increase in net running profits of $561,397 and Increase the Web revenue by 7.9%, nevertheless generating the investment desirable. About the flip aspect, If your spa would make no revenue ($0 in earnings) and you do not enhance your ADR, your NOI declines 3.1% and your net financial gain decreases by seven.4%, which following paying $2,000,000 which might not be the most beneficial condition presented the opportunity expense of the financial commitment. A different matter to take a look at is if the spa will make no cash ($0 in revenue) and you may a minimum of raise the common daily level and occupancy, NOI enhances seven% and Internet revenue 3% which remains to be up, but consider the investment. It will consider 15 yrs to find out any return. The challenge is, and this doesn't get any expertise to appreciate, if you aren't making income in the spa, you are still expending it.
